Do you have experience in food safety and quality assurance and are looking for a hands-on role within a well-established business that offers excellent development opportunities?
On offer is the chance to join a growing business where you will take full ownership of the QA, ensuring the business maintains extremely high standards of food hygiene, compliance, and audit preparedness at all times. The company is well established, operating a busy production site with a strong focus on quality and continuous improvement. You will be supported by an experienced Compliance Manager, ensuring thorough and structured training.
This would suit someone with a background in food quality assurance, ideally a technician ready to step up into a more senior position.
The Role:
- Lead the site QA function and maintain audit readiness
- Conduct internal and external audits, laboratory testing, and traceability checks
- Manage supplier risk and compliance
The Person:
- Experience in a QA or food safety role within a food production environment
- Familiarity with HACCP / GMP or similar
- Looking for a varied role at a growing company
